Environmental Conservation Project: Planting 10,000 Trees
Our environmental initiative has successfully planted 10,000 trees across 25 communities, contributing to climate action and environmental sustainability.
Our environmental conservation project has made significant strides in promoting sustainability and combating climate change. We successfully planted 10,000 trees across 25 different communities, involving local residents, students, and volunteers in the initiative. The project focused on planting native tree species that are well-suited to the local climate and soil conditions. Regular maintenance and monitoring ensure high survival rates. The initiative also included awareness programs about environmental conservation, climate change, and the importance of trees. This project has not only contributed to carbon sequestration but also improved local biodiversity and created green spaces for communities to enjoy.
